Freddie Roach Talks About Mayweather vs Pacquiao 2

Hall of Fame trainer Freddie Roach is back in Manny Pacquiao’s corner for his big upcoming fight with Adrien Broner on Showtime pay per view that takes place on January 19th at the MGM Grand in Las Vegas.

The biggest fight the two ever had together was of course against Floyd Mayweather back in May 2015 in a bout that ultimately Mayweather won by decision.

It still has left a bad taste in the mouth of Freddie Roach however to this day — as he always felt that Pacquiao’s shoulder injury hampered their chances in the bout.

Speaking to Fight Hype Freddie Roach said of Mayweather and Pacquiao’s meeting at the LA Clippers basketball game this week:

“I’m sure he gave him a Manny Pacquiao t-shirt! Good, Floyd put himself on TV for a reason. He wants people to still know that he’s still fighting, that he’s still in action. He won by knockout. He fought a smaller person. He’s in the limelight again. For this fight or any future fight to happen things like that (for publicity purposes) have to happen. The winner of this fight (Pacquiao vs Broner) may get him. We hope so — but we don’t know yet. We can only concentrate on one fight at a time.”

He added:

“No, I’d like to see Mayweather (for Manny next if he beats Broner). I want that one more time!”

It would seem that all signs are pointing to a rematch this summer at this time.

That said, Pacquiao must first get past a dangerous opponent who is younger than him in the form of Adrien Broner next up.

If he does, expect a rematch with Mayweather in the summer.
